- Rannaghore Ke-a fun adda with old and new friends about food, life and everything else. This is episode 3 with Sachiko Seth, the young restaurateur who runs the popular Tibetan-Nepali-style restaurant near Maidan, called Blue Poppy Thakali.
Join us as Sachiko cooks the famous Kalimpong street food, alu thukpa (noodles with Nepali alu dum), and shaphalay (wrappers filled with pork keema and deep-fried).

Loved to watch this episode. I feel nostalgic regarding Blue Poppy as we often used to get good food from there when it was across City Centre in Mizoram House and then in Sikkim House. Excellent Chinese food. I would still vouch for it. And it's momos are heaven. Nothing like Blue Poppy Momos. I even remember an incident that once we were eating in the Mizoram House Blue Poppy and had already started digging into our Manchurian chicken. Doma Wang came , replaced it with another new Manchurian chicken on her own stating that the first dish had spoilt chicken. She actually did it on her own and we were very impressed by her Swift action. No restaurant till date does that. Such honesty !!! I wish them all the success !!! 🤗🤗🤗
